None of the above.Long Con wrote:Epig, can you tell the story again of the time that you went rogue against your baddie team and outed them all? Was that what happened? Did you turn rogue based on your role, or did you just decide to "go rogue" on your own to shake things up as a big gambit to win? Or even just... for a laugh?
In Bioshock Mafia, I was on a team with Snow Dog, Hedgeowl, DFaraday, and Bullzeye. Our team was fully in tact for much of the game. However, I got "hypnotized" by an independent, Nevinera. I was drinking a good bit that night when it happened and I foolishly copied and pasted the entire PM to my teammates. Upon realizing my error, and, being the only one with a full knowledge of the video game, I bluffed about returning to the team at a certain point in the story (Point Prometheus, to be exact). I even went so far as to make up PMs from the host and paste those in the chat room. I had a kill, and my new partner had a kill, so on Night 8, we took out two of my team, and someone else just happened to be killed coincidentally. Unfortunately, I got hypnotized again by Lorab, but that didn't matter much: I had been in a conference in Charlotte, and on the way home, the bus broke down at a McDonald's. I used Micky D's Wifi to get in a quick vote for DisgruntledPorcupine, but that's about all I could do. That was enough to get people talking about me and when I got home, I was lynched. Nevinera actually went on to win with the neutral roles. Crazy stuff.
